Graduation, Transfer-out, and Retention Rate Trends at LCAD
The average graduation rate over the past 12 years (2012-2023) is 59.00% where the last year rate was 63%. The average retention rate of the last 12 years is 79.82% for full-time students and 66.64% for part-time students.

Retention Rate Changes
The average retention rate of the last 12 years is 79.82% for full-time students and 66.64% for part-time students.
